This salad is jam packed with nutrients such as Vitamins A, C, B6 and Folate. These nutrients are responsible for promoting healthy eyesight, immune function, and skin health.
You can also get a healthy dose of dietary fiber from this great tasting salad.
Here’s my Spinach Beet and Pomegranate Citrus Salad recipe
Ingredients
4 cups spinach (washed, drained)
3 Tablespoons fresh Pomegranate seeds (click here for how to De-seed a Pomegranate)
1/2 cup freshly squeezed Grapefruit juice
1 teaspoon Agave syrup
1 small Beet
1 Tablespoon Sunflower seeds
METHOD
– Place a pot of water on to boil
– Wash and peel beet

– Cut in half, lengthways. Take one half and cut into slices about a 1/4 inch thick. Repeat with the other half


– Place beet slices in a colander and place over pot of boiling water. Cover and steam beet slices for 10 minutes

– Set aside to cool
– In a small bowl, combine 1/2 cup freshly sqeezed grapefruit juice and 1 teaspoon Agave syrup. Mix well and set aside
– Wash and drain spinach
– Line a serving dish with washed and drained spinach.

– Drizzle 3 Tablespoons of citrus dressing on the layered spinach
– Next, spread beet slices on top of spinach layer
– Sprinkle 3 Tablespoons Pomegranate seeds and 1 Tablespoon sunflower seeds on top of spinach and beet
– Drizzle another Tablespoon of citrus dressing on the salad
– Serve and enjoy!

TIP: Remainder of Citrus dressing can be refrigerated or drizzled on top of individual salad portions.
